Abstract:
      Natural element method(NEM) is a new numerical computational method based on Voronoi diagram and Delaunay triangulation.It is a Galerkin-based meshless method built on the natural neighbor interpolation shape function.The first and second derivatives of natural neighbor Laplace interpolation function in NEM are deduced and the governing equations of natural element method to the deflection solution of elastic thin plate bending on Winkler soil foundation are achieved.Numerical results indicate that the above theory and the corresponding program are feasible and effective.
